B. Rajewsky is a scholar working on Radiology, Nuclear Medicine and Imaging, Biophysics and Molecular Biology. According to data from OpenAlex, B. Rajewsky has authored 52 papers receiving a total of 256 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Radiology, Nuclear Medicine and Imaging, 7 papers in Biophysics and 6 papers in Molecular Biology. Recurrent topics in B. Rajewsky’s work include Effects of Radiation Exposure (5 papers), Chemical Reactions and Isotopes (4 papers) and Radiation Dose and Imaging (4 papers). B. Rajewsky is often cited by papers focused on Effects of Radiation Exposure (5 papers), Chemical Reactions and Isotopes (4 papers) and Radiation Dose and Imaging (4 papers). B. Rajewsky collaborates with scholars based in Germany. B. Rajewsky's co-authors include W. Stahlhofen, Klaus Dose, K. Dose, H. Muth, G. Peter, Francesco Bresciani, H. Pauly, Robert A. Pape, A. Kaul and O. Hug and has published in prestigious journals such as Nature, Archives of Biochemistry and Biophysics and Photochemistry and Photobiology.
